Csn Early Childhood Education Lab School

Csn Early Childhood Education Lab School serves 76 students in grades Prekindergarten-Kindergarten, is a member of the National Association for the Education of Young Children.
The student:teacher of Csn Early Childhood Education Lab School is 76:1.

Quick Stats (2025)

  • School Type: Early Childhood / Day Care
  • Grades: Prekindergarten-Kindergarten
  • Enrollment: 76 students
  • Yearly Tuition: $2,700
  • Application Deadline: None / Rolling
  • Source: National Center for Education Statistics (NCES)
